Output edaaa8cc5373159068fa6de25f3afbc6970c4c0bd5c1400e5bc2b7c36c95cf3e:3

value
682961
script pubkey
OP_0 OP_PUSHBYTES_20 2e696f34d3bda1518f40031f54d50bed980c0155
address
tb1q9e5k7dxnhks4rr6qqv04f4gtakvqcq24xre0nx
transaction
edaaa8cc5373159068fa6de25f3afbc6970c4c0bd5c1400e5bc2b7c36c95cf3e